T. Chandra has authored 44 papers that have received a total of 1.2k indexed citations.
This includes 35 papers in Mechanical Engineering, 20 papers in Mechanics of Materials and 16 papers in Materials Chemistry. The topics of these papers are Microstructure and Mechanical Properties of Steels (17 papers), Metallurgy and Material Forming (16 papers) and Metal Alloys Wear and Properties (10 papers). T. Chandra is often cited by papers focused on Microstructure and Mechanical Properties of Steels (17 papers), Metallurgy and Material Forming (16 papers) and Metal Alloys Wear and Properties (10 papers) and collaborates with scholars based in Australia, Canada and Iran. T. Chandra's co-authors include P. Manohar, Michael Ferry, D.P. Dunne, John J. Jonas and David Wexler and has published in prestigious journals such as Journal of Materials Science, Composites Science and Technology and Physica C Superconductivity.
